Helical Piers Installation in Tampa, FL
Helical piers installation is a foundation support method used to stabilize and strengthen properties with uneven or weak soil conditions. This service involves the use of steel shafts that are screwed into the ground to provide a solid base for structures such as decks, porches, additions, or repair projects. Property owners typically request helical pier installation when experiencing issues like settling foundations, uneven flooring, or when planning new construction on challenging soil types, especially in areas like Tampa, FL where soil conditions can vary.
Before requesting helical piers installation,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the project, including the number of piers needed, the depth required for proper support, and the types of structures that can benefit. It’s also helpful to consider the soil conditions and any existing foundation issues that may influence the installation process. Clear communication about these factors can ensure the project is tailored to meet the specific needs of the property and provides long-lasting stability.

Helical Piers Installation Questions
What are helical piers used for? Helical piers provide stable support for structures like decks, additions, and foundations in areas with challenging soil conditions.
How do helical piers install into the ground? They are screwed into the soil using specialized equipment, creating a secure foundation without extensive excavation.
Are helical piers suitable for all types of properties? They are effective for residential and commercial projects, especially where traditional footing installation is difficult.
What property features benefit most from helical pier installation? Properties with poor soil stability, high water tables, or limited access often see the most benefit from this method.
